oracle设置id自动增长 oracle如何实现主键id自增,或自动生成?

oracle如何实现主键id自增,或自动生成?首先,你必须有一张桌子!Create table example(IDnumber(4)not number primary key,name varch

oracle如何实现主键id自增,或自动生成?

首先,你必须有一张桌子!Create table example(IDnumber(4)not number primary key,name varchar(25),phone varchar(10),address varchar(50))如果您对上述建表语句有任何疑问,建议您不要继续!如果有时间,不妨去看看金庸,读琼瑶!然后,需要一个自定义的sequencecreatesequenceemp Sequence incrementby1—一次添加几个starthith1—从1开始计数,nomaxvalue—不设置最大值,nocycle—一直累积,不循环,nocache—不构建缓冲区。上面的代码完成了创建一个序列的过程,名为EMP_uu序列,范围从1到无穷大(无穷大的程度由您的机器决定)。不骑自行车就是决定不骑自行车。如果设置最大值,可以使用cycle将SEQ设置为最大值,然后循环。